Kate Beckinsale has signed to star in The Savior, an action thriller from director Russell Mulcahy that follows a mother who must resurrect her violent past to rescue her kidnapped daughter from ruthless human traffickers, MovieWeb reported Jan. 29, 2026. Mulcahy, best known for the 1986 cult classic Highlander, also directed The Shadow and Resident Evil: Extinction and will helm the new film.

The Savior was written by Marc Furmie and Jason Mavraidis, based on a story by Corey Large. Filming on The Savior is expected to begin next month, with Large producing the project under his 308 Ent banner. Deadline describes the film as a wild combination of Man on Fire, Collateral and Sicario, with the atmosphere of Prisoners and Se7en, and MovieWeb suggested that mix points to a darker, more nightmarish take on the parent-rescue action subgenre.

Beckinsale returns to familiar territory after recent action roles in Canary Black, Stolen Girl and last year’s Wildcat, and first rose to action prominence with the Underworld franchise beginning in 2003.
